altify:用微软的深度学习理解图片
来源:互联网 发布:淘宝助理导出没有图片 编辑:程序博客网 时间:2024/05/02 00:30
github上有个项目叫altify,使用微软的视觉学习来理解图片,地址:https://github.com/ParhamP/altify
下面直接上代码,学习使用。
1、altify
打开cmd,输入:
pip install altify
便可以下载和安装altify包
2、登陆微软的深度学习服务,并订阅免费的服务:
网址:https://www.microsoft.com/cognitive-services/en-us
然后,选中你要订阅的Computer Vision - Preview,如:
这里可以获取到api_key
3、打开pycharm或python,输入以下的命令行:
# -*- coding: utf-8 -*-import jsonimport requestsapi_url = 'http://api.projectoxford.ai/vision/v1.0/describe'#api_key,这里修改为你自己的api_key = "f17693bccf58488094b67922b6490adf" #图片链接,可以修改image_src = "https://a-ssl.duitang.com/uploads/item/201612/09/20161209120138_QLvG8.thumb.700_0.jpeg"_maxNumRetries = 10# 测试图片headers = { # Request headers 'Content-Type': 'application/json', 'Ocp-Apim-Subscription-Key': api_key,}data = { # Request parameters 'maxCandidates': '1', "Url": image_src,}data = json.dumps(data, separators=(',',':'))r = requests.post(api_url, data = data, headers = headers)captioned_data = r.json()['description']['captions'][0]["text"]print(captioned_data)# 测试返回为 'a woman standing in front of a building'
到这里便可以直接运行了,预祝顺利!
1 0
- altify:用微软的深度学习理解图片
- R语言:用微软的深度学习理解图片情感
- 深度学习基本概念的理解
- 理解深度学习的局限性
- 深度学习的简单理解
- 用自己的图片数据做tensorflow深度学习
- R语言:用微软的深度学习得到人脸的特征数据
- 微软:我家的深度学习超越了人类和Google
- 在win7下配置微软的深度学习caffe
- 在win7下配置微软的深度学习caffe
- 对“深度学习”的一些理解
- 深度学习之前的基础知识理解
- 深度学习中对神经网络的理解
- 关于深度学习中Dropout的理解
- 深度学习-图像识别更多的理解
- 深度学习GPU卡的理解(一)
- 深度学习GPU卡的理解(二)
- 深度学习GPU卡的理解(三)
- elasticsearch-jdbc插件快速部署和要点说明
- VBA序列化指定区域的数据
- AngularJS资源合集[备忘]【申明:来源于网络】
- Sublime Text 高级替换功能 Demo - 利用正则表达式修改内容
- log4j使用
- altify:用微软的深度学习理解图片
- Windows下Nginx+Tomcat整合的安装与配置
- SpringMVC中Controller的@ResponseBody注解分析
- 年度最重磅:极速手机建站做场景-动力逐浪全新发布
- unity引擎声音格式的选择------转载请注明出处:Channel游戏音乐工作室---转
- css清除浮动float的三种方法总结,为什么清浮动?浮动会有那些影响?
- mysql 远程访问不行解决方法 Host is not allowed to connect to this MySQL server
- ionic的window环境下安装
- bzoj 1024